Gauripur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ights

As per the 2011 Census, Gauripur Village has a population of 459 (459) with 222 (222) males and 237 (237) females.The sex ratio in Gauripur is 1068,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.

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Gauripur Village is 58 (58) which is 12.64% of Gauripur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Gauripur Village is 1231 females for every 1000 males.

Note : In the 2011 Census, Gauripur village is listed as part of the Goghat - II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Hugli District in the state of WEST BENGAL in INDIA.

The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Gauripur Literacy Rate

Gauripur Village has a literacy rate of 68.83%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Gauripur Village is 82.65 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Gauripur Village is 55.61 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Gauripur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population

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Gauripur Village is 285 (285) with 142 (142) males and 143 (143) females, which is 62.09% of Gauripur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1008 females for every 1000 males.

Gauripur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population

Scheduled Tribes Population in Gauripur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Gauripur Village.

Gauripur Area & Households

The Total Number of households in Gauripur Village are 113 (113).

Gauripur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view

In Gauripur Village, there are about 150 (150) workers, making up nearly 32.68% of the Gauripur Village total population. Out of these, around 132 (132) are male workers, and about 18 (18) are female workers.
